Abstract EN
A new systematic synthesis framework for reflectarray antennas is discussed.
Optimization based on the Levenberg-Marquardt algorithm is used to obtain the phase distribution of the reflection coefficients required on the reflectarray surface, in order to achieve the pattern specifications.
A Local Multipoint Distribution System (LMDS) base station working in the 24.5–26.5 GHz frequency band has been proposed to evaluate the method.
The 3D requirements are defined by the combination of the elevation and templates and considering a maximum acceptable ripple in the beam shaping.
Some illustrative results are obtained.
